Cisco Systems
Cisco’s Industrial Routers portfolio, including the IR1101 and Catalyst IR8300 series, provides enterprise-grade 5G connectivity with integrated SD-WAN capabilities for mission-critical industrial applications. The routers feature hardened enclosures rated for extended temperature ranges, multiple cellular carrier support, and Cisco IOS XE software for advanced security and network management. Cisco’s strength lies in seamless integration with existing enterprise network infrastructure and comprehensive lifecycle management through DNA Center. The company’s established presence in industrial sectors such as manufacturing, oil and gas, and utilities provides extensive deployment experience, though pricing typically positions Cisco solutions at premium market tiers.
-
Sierra Wireless (now part of Semtech)
Sierra Wireless AirLink routers, including the XR90 5G model, deliver industrial-grade connectivity with a focus on transportation, public safety, and energy infrastructure. The XR90 supports 5G NR, LTE-A Pro, and multi-network failover with sub-second switchover times. Devices feature ignition sensing for mobile applications, GNSS positioning, and compatibility with Sierra Wireless’s AirLink Management Service (ALMS) for centralized remote management of distributed deployments. The company’s long heritage in M2M communication and cellular module manufacturing provides deep wireless technology expertise, with particular strength in North American transportation and public safety sectors.
-
Peplink
Peplink’s MAX Transit 5G and MAX HD4 5G routers emphasize multi-WAN bonding and failover capabilities for mobile and fixed industrial deployments. The company’s SpeedFusion technology enables bandwidth aggregation across multiple cellular connections and VPN tunneling for enhanced reliability. Peplink devices support up to 8 cellular connections with intelligent load balancing and include built-in WiFi 6 access points. The routers target applications in emergency response vehicles, maritime vessels, and mobile command centers where unbreakable connectivity is critical. Peplink’s InControl cloud management platform provides zero-touch provisioning and remote diagnostics across globally distributed device fleets.
-
Digi International
Digi’s EX50 5G Enterprise Router delivers high-performance connectivity for industrial IoT edge applications with emphasis on security and remote management. The device combines 5G/4G LTE cellular with dual Gigabit Ethernet, serial ports, and I/O for legacy equipment integration. Digi TrustFence security framework provides multi-layered protection, including secure boot, encrypted storage, and authenticated firmware updates. Digi Remote Manager enables centralized configuration, monitoring, and troubleshooting of distributed router deployments. The company serves industrial automation, smart cities, and retail sectors with particular strength in North American markets and established partnerships with major cellular carriers.
-
Teltonika Networks
Teltonika’s RUTX50 5G industrial router provides cost-effective cellular connectivity for IoT applications with comprehensive protocol support and industrial I/O capabilities. The device features dual SIM with automatic failover, RutOS operating system with 200+ network protocols, RS232/RS485 serial interfaces, and digital input/output for industrial equipment integration. Teltonika routers support MQTT, Modbus, and other industrial protocols for seamless integration with SCADA and automation systems. The company’s Remote Management System (RMS) enables centralized device configuration and monitoring. Teltonika targets small to medium-scale industrial deployments with competitive pricing and strong European market presence.
-
Robustel
Robustel’s R5020 5G industrial cellular router combines high-speed wireless connectivity with edge computing capabilities for demanding industrial applications. The device supports 5G NR Sub-6GHz, dual SIM failover, and provides multiple Gigabit Ethernet ports, serial interfaces, and digital I/O. Robustel routers feature industrial enclosures with wide operating temperature ranges and DIN-rail mounting options. The company’s RCMS cloud platform enables remote configuration, monitoring, and firmware management across distributed deployments. Robustel serves industrial automation, smart grid, transportation, and security sectors with a focus on Asia-Pacific and European markets, offering flexible customization options for OEM integrators.
